Abstract | The 80 confirmed and suspected mercury manganese stars identified prior to 1974 and north of declination -20° have been studied from 654 high dispersion spectrograms (2.4-15Å mm ⁻¹) for velocity and degree of peculiarity. The binary frequency based on velocity variability criteria alone appears to be a normal main sequence value of about 50 percent, and is probably independent of the degree of enhancement of the mercury amd manganese lines. New spectroscopic orbital elements are given for six systems: α And, 2 Per, κ Cnc, φ Her, HR 6620 and 46 Dra. The Hg Mn spectroscopic binaries appear to be fairly normal in their orbital characteristics, except that periods less than 3 days are conspicuously absent; there is also weak evidence for more nearly circular orbits amongst the short period Hg Mn binaries than in comparable normal binaries. |
